Detectives and investigators must be mindful of the law when conducting investigations. Because they lack police authority, their work must be done with the same authority as a private citizen. As a result, detectives and investigators must have a good understanding of federal, state, and local laws, such as privacy laws, and other legal issues affecting their work.

Vigilantes, private individuals with no formal authority acting in self-interest or in the interests of a specific group, served as enforcers. The first American vigilantes, the South Carolina Regulators, appeared in 1767 but only really flourished after 1850. During the 1800s, because public police were limited by geographic jurisdiction, private security filled the need for an agency that could chase fleeing offenders across city, county, or state lines and became a growth industry. Private detectives and investigators work in many places, depending on their assignment or case. Some spend more time in offices, researching cases on computers, while others spend more time in the field, conducting interviews and performing surveillance. Many private detectives spend considerable time researching and compiling data online. The internet, social media and various online databases can help solve and wrap up investigations, so an understanding of computer science can be one of the handiest and most-used tools in a private detective’s toolbox. Once you have met all the requirements for your PI application, it is important to prepare for the licensing exam. Topics on your state exam may include state and federal law, criminal justice, as well as investigation procedures and protocols. The length and overall difficulty of the licensing exam depends on your state’s curriculum, and you may be able to find a study guide on the state department of licensing website.

A private detective and investigator searches for clues to gather evidence for court cases or private clients. They interview people, verify information, conduct surveillance, find missing persons, and gather vital facts for cases. Depending on their area of expertise, they might be hired to investigate computer crimes or corporate to help solve a case. Private detectives and investigators must typically have previous work experience, usually in law enforcement, the military, or federal intelligence. Those in such jobs, who are frequently able to retire after 20 or 25 years of service, may become private detectives or investigators in a second career.
